About Addis Ababa Bole International Airport
Addis Ababa Airport (ADD) is the main airport of Ethiopia and one of the busiest hubs in Africa, sitting about 6 kilometres southeast of the city centre at over 2,300 metres above sea level. It works from two terminals: Terminal 1 for domestic and regional flights, and the much larger Terminal 2 for international services.
Bole is the home of Ethiopian Airlines, the largest carrier on the continent, and it is one of the fastest-growing transfer points between Africa, the Gulf, Europe and Asia. Turkish Airlines, Emirates, Qatar Airways and flydubai also operate here. Because a great many passengers change planes without ever leaving the building, a lost item can go missing in transit rather than at a single gate.
How to Report a Lost Item at Bole Airport
If you are still airside, the quickest route is one of the information desks in the departure and arrival halls, where staff can point you to the lost property office. If you have already cleared the airport, note your flight, the terminal, and where you think the item went astray, then make contact.

Something left on your aircraft ?
Items found in the cabin are returned by the crew to the airline, not the airport, so reach out to your carrier (for example Ethiopian Airlines or Kenya Airways) quoting your booking reference, flight number and seat number.

Common Places Travellers Lose Something at Bole Airport
With heavy transfer traffic and two terminals, items most often surface at:
- Security screening at the terminal entrance and the transfer checkpoint
- Boarding gates and the transit lounges used between connections
- Immigration and the visa desks
- Duty-free shops and cafes in Terminal 2
- The baggage reclaim halls
Our Tips For Making Your Report Count
A precise report is far easier to act on at a busy hub like Addis airport :
- Say whether you were arriving, departing or connecting, and name both flights if you were in transit
- Give the terminal and, if you can, the gate or lounge
- Describe the item with make, colour and contents
- Keep your boarding passes and bag tags
- Report the same day if possible, before the item moves into storage
Where to Collect a Found Item
Recovered items are collected from the lost property office with matching identification. If you cannot return to Addis Ababa, you can authorise someone to collect on your behalf in writing, with copies of your ID and theirs.
Recovering an Item After You Have Flown On
Yes, it is possible from abroad, as long as the item reached the office. Confirm that it is being held, then arrange collection by a trusted contact or a courier. Move quickly for passports, phones and documents, since items are only stored for a set period.
Some Things Worth Knowing about Bole Airport
How many terminals does Addis Ababa Bole Airport have?
Two. Terminal 1 handles domestic and regional flights and Terminal 2 handles international services, so it is worth noting which one you used.
I lost something while connecting. Who do I contact?
Mention both flights when you report. Staff may need to check the transit area and both gates, and if the item was in the cabin, the operating airline handles it.
Does Ethiopian Airlines look for items left on board?
Yes. Cabin crew hand in items found on the aircraft to the airline’s baggage service, so you contact the carrier rather than the airport for onboard losses.
